Subject: Quickstore 4.2 — bloom filter now fronts the KV layer

Plugin authors: starting with this release, Quickstore places a bloom filter ahead of the key-value store. Negative lookups return faster; false positives fall through safely. No API changes are required on your side. Verify your plugin against the staging build referenced below.

session token of fahif-tadup = htk3_9c7

# Pindlewick Environments

The Pindlewick gateway now wraps all calls to the upstream Quotaire API in a circuit breaker. Staging trips after five consecutive failures and holds open for sixty seconds; production is stricter, tripping after three. Half-open probes go through a single canary worker. This change goes live Thursday; Ravi will demo trip behavior at the sync. For reference ahead of the discussion, the current breaker configuration for both environments is shown below.

config for hahaf-kafof:
[wenys]
host = wenys.torvahq.corp
user = wenys_svc
database = wenys_prod

## Deployment

Ormbreaker replaces the legacy Quillbase ORM layer in Tally-Ledger. Deploys go through the gray channel only; no blue/green. Support: do not roll back past build 118 — schema shims were removed. Health check lives at the usual admin port. If customers report stale reads, it's almost always the mapper cache, not the database. Restart clears it. Each environment reads one config file at boot, reproduced here for reference:

deployment values, yadug-bawif:
[framir]
team = pelox
access_code = ac_a38ab2
owner = tamion.julael
host = framir.tolvaqlabs.test
port = 11211
peer = tammir.zemvargrid.local
salt = 2215ef03
pin = 1541

## Formula sandbox tuning

User-supplied formulas in Gridmoor execute inside a restricted interpreter with hard ceilings on time, memory, and call depth. Reviewers should confirm any change to these ceilings is justified in the PR description, since raising them widens the abuse surface. Defaults were chosen from production traces. The current limits are as follows.

limits module of tafog-fawip:
WEIGHTS = {
    "julix": 57,
    "lamys": 992,
    "kasvan": 209,
    "quenok": 750,
    "alddor": 259,
    "oliath": 1009,
    "wenix": 815,
}